Cushman & Wakefield is hiring a Surveyor for the London Tenant Representation team, focusing on office strategy across Central London. This role involves managing client relationships, overseeing office searches, and providing financial analysis as part of a high-profile advisory team.
The ideal candidate will have:
- An understanding of the London office market
- Strong negotiation skills
- The ability to deliver accurate documentation
